Are You Receiving the Accessibility Tips and Tricks?
- Learn to make information accessible to people with disabilities
- Implement what you learn right away
- Understand how people with disabilities use technology
- Receive our monthly newsletter packed with news, articles and updates
- Bonus workbook: Ten steps to a more accessible web site
Do you need help with accessibility? Hire us!
Do I Have to Learn Programming to Make My Site Accessible?
“Web accessibility? Sounds like a technical thing! I think I have to learn programming for it, right?”
Well, the answer to this relies on a few factors. Here we will take a Look at each one to help you figure out the answer for yourself.
What is Programming?
Before we continue, let us first have a simple definition of programming. In the context of the Internet, programming consists of techniques and procedures for creating web pages, their structure, and their content.
Having a Web Development Team
If you have your own web development team, they will do all the programming tasks for you. This includes the procedures related to accessibility. So in this case, you do not have to learn programming, unless you want to directly work with your team on your site’s accessibility.
Although you don’t have to learn programming, you at least have to know the basics of web site structure and content. In addition, you need to have an idea on how persons with disabilities use the Internet. These things would help you understand why you need to make changes to your site.
You also have to make sure your team clearly understands web accessibility. This may involve setting up a web accessibility training for your developers.
Working on a Small Site
On the other hand, let us say you choose to have a small web site. Here, you would work on all aspects of the site, including content management and web development. Since a part of web accessibility involves using the correct tags and attributes, you need to learn web programming to make your site accessible.
But this wouldn’t be a problem, because if you are planning or are currently working on your own site, you may already know how to make web pages anyway. Similar to the previous scenario, you would understand accessibility better once you learn how disabled persons browse the Net.
Using a Content Management System
More and more people are now using content management systems like Drupal and Wordpress. A content management system (CMS) is a collection of tools that let you create, organize, modify, and remove information in your web pages.
Using a CMS requires little or no background on web programming. This means that if you use a CMS, you can make your site accessible without having too much programming skills. You nonetheless need to know how to make your content accessible through your chosen CMS.
Helping in Making a Site Accessible
You can still help make a site accessible even if you are not the one creating it and you have no programming background. Simple tasks such as organizing information and ensuring good structure can contribute to a site’s accessibility. You can also help in the accessibility of word documents, PDF files, and spreadsheets which developers upload to the site.
Conclusion
The answer to whether or not you need programming skills for your site’s accessibility depends on your situation. If you have a web development team, you don’t have to learn the technical side of accessibility. If you choose to work on your own, you must learn programming to make your site accessible.
In any event, you need to understand how certain people access the Internet. Through this, you would appreciate the real purpose of making your site accessible.








Designers and content providers
Designers and content providers also have a big impact on web accessibility. Some ways where they can help are by providing: inclusion of button with select dropdown; sufficient color contrast; text for heading and form labels; and effective link text. Also remember that management must firmly back the need for accessibility.
good topic:)
that's a good questions, CMS has made life much easier these days and whenever a person need extra functionality he can just get a plugin
thank u:)
Simple HTML and Java scripting
you must have an idea of simple HTML so when are going to make any changes your own ....it can be done only in few minutes rather than wasting so much time...
Nice article, I was looking
Nice article, I was looking for these kind of information.
Please continue writing....
Thanks
Thanks for this awesome post.
Thanks for this awesome post. I was looking for this kind of information. Please continue writing....
Post new comment